Output c6d8d8b5e6cd96e173f69bc23fbb3d9e7b4ba43c6591a53381aa03fddb29a282:1

value
19327099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1da34a677cd54672d5a30fba5caefa17061bb9de OP_EQUAL
address
34Pj8jqzB5AhN6WorEkoz47RxD5n7aHFiX
transaction
c6d8d8b5e6cd96e173f69bc23fbb3d9e7b4ba43c6591a53381aa03fddb29a282
confirmations
458407
spent
true